Synthesis and Characterization of Quaterrylene Bisimide as NIR Colorant

Abstract
Recently, Near-infrared (NIR)colorant is intriguing and attractive but full of challenges. Although some cyanine colorant have been commercialized, near-infrared colorant with intensive NIR absorption, good chemical and photo-stability, and high solubility still remain as target compound. Certain polycyclic aromatic compounds such as quaterrylene represent a key class of NIR colorant and also give rise to outstanding physical and chemical properties after appropriate chemical modification. In this study, We have tried to introduceimide functional group to quaterrylene in order to give chemical and thermal stability. Finally, N,N'-bis (2,6-diisopropylphenyl)-quarterrylene-3,4:13,14-tetracarboximide was synthesized and evaluated its properties using $^1H$ NMR, Maldi-tof, TGA, and UV/VIS/NIR spectroscopy as NIR colorant. The quaterrylene bisimide compound exhibit a excellent thermal stability and chemical stability.
